Overview LMI is seeking a cybersecurity senior expert and consultant to advise on the development and integration of cybersecurity and testing practices for technologies used by first responders. Applicants must show demonstrated cyber/IT related experience in operations, strategic planning, project management, and technical SME customer interactions. Candidates must have the ability to obtain a government security clearance. " Target salary range: $104040 - $183600. Final compensation will be determined by a variety of factors including but not limited to your skills, experience, education, and/or certifications." Responsibilities * Provide technical advice and practical guidance on cybersecurity of first responder technologies. * Develop a series of products that explore cybersecurity vulnerabilities, risks, and trade-offs, in first responder relevant terms, of connected technologies and their associated impacts to their mission, including but not limited to the following products: * Rapid Risk Assessment Form: allows public safety agencies to better assess technology vendors' and/or products' cybersecurity posture. * Integrated Incident Response Plan Template: for both incident commanders and cybersecurity specialist. * Best Practices for Fielded Connected Devices: considerations and options that account for public safety operational needs * Conduct vulnerability assessments and third party reviews of connected devices and planned or installed information systems to identify vulnerabilities, risks, and protection needs. Technology/devices are selected based on: Proliferation, Priority, Impact, and Demand. * Oversee risk analysis, feasibility studies, and/or trade-off analysis to develop, document, and refine a cybersecurity program. * Consult with customers to gather and evaluate functional requirements and translate requirements into technical solutions. * Provide solutions which first responders can implement to reduce cybersecurity vulnerabilities. * Catalogue existing tools used to identify and mitigate cybersecurity vulnerabilities for different technology areas. * Promote awareness of cyber policy and strategy as appropriate and ensure sound principles are reflected in the organization's mission, vision, and goals. * Develop interim and final products in formats useful to customers, to include written reports, briefings, quick look analyses, checklists and guides, among other related documentation. Qualifications Required Qualifications: * BS deg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Software and Systems Engineering, or other STEM field of study. * 10+ years of relevant experience in IT Security, RF Security and/or cybersecurity mission related work * Occasional travel required to various test sites * Ability to pass a DHS background investigation * Ability to obtain TS/SCI clearance * Proficiency with the use of penetration testing hardware and software * Excellent verbal and written communication skills * Ability to effectively collaborate in team environments and with internal and external customers * Demonstrated analytical and problem-solving capabilities * Strong team player with customer-focused attitude Desired Skills and Experience: * Ability to leverage best practices and lessons learned of state and local government organizations dealing with cyber issues. * Familiarity with applicable laws, statutes, Presidential Directives, and executive branch guidelines related to cyber. * Understanding of the trade-offs between cybersecurity best practices and operational impact for front line first responders. * Solid working knowledge of system engineering and system architecture principles, or RF Security (i.e., integrating and testing RF and digital components) * Experience serving as a technical mentor to DHS employees in cybersecurity roles and end-user operators in the field. * Experience utilizing cutting-edge knowledge of computer hardware, software, and networks to conduct cybersecurity activities and tasks, including but not limited to: * Wireshark * NESSUS * Tenable * Network Security Monitoring Tools * Encryption Tools * Web Vulnerability Scanning Tools * Penetration Testing Tools * Network Intrusion Detection Tools * Virus Scanning Tools * Firewall Tools * Managed detection services * Desired certifications, such as: * CompTIA Security+ Certification * CompTIA PenTest+ *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) * CompTIA CySA+ Certification *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P)
